Interestingly, the GMC Hummer EV Pickup and GMC Hummer EV SUV don’t just look different – they’re sized differently as well. The Pickup is a bit longer, measuring in with a 135.6-inch wheel base and 216.8-inch overall length, as compared to the SUV’s 126.7-inch wheelbase and 196.8-inch overall length. The Pickup is also a tick shorter at 80.9 inches, as compared to an overall height of 81.1 inches for the SUV. There’s also a big chassis difference between the Pickup and SUV body styles, as GM Authority exclusively covered last month.
Of course, one of the biggest visual differences between the GMC Hummer EV Pickup and GMC Hummer EV SUV is around the rear end, where the roofline on the Pickup drops down into the bed, while the roofline on the SUV continues straight back to form a 90-degree angle before falling into the rear hatch section.
As for the exterior hues, the 2023 GMC Hummer EV Pickup and 2023 GMC Hummer EV SUV offer identical paint options, with the exception of the range-topping Edition 1 models. The GMC Hummer EV Pickup Edition 1 is finished exclusively in Interstellar White, while the SUV Edition 1 is finished exclusively in Moonshot Green Matter (although the SUV was almost finished in another color, as GM Authority exclusively covered in February).
Both body styles are equipped with GM Ultium batteries and GM Ultium Drive motors, and both ride on the GM BT1 platform. GMC Hummer EV production takes place at the GM Factory Zero plant in Michigan.
